855 views
1 application 0 responses
Our client is one of the largest television manufacturers in the world. The project is about 3 years old, an exciting and complex project.
The project's goal is to create a platform for the next generation of TVs based on the web engine.
A great opportunity for users to watch non-streaming services, and videos without any delays with excellent quality and distribute videos to TV via phone (Android, iOS).
Requirements:
- BA/BS in Computer Science or Engineering, or equivalent experience
- Excellent Linux skills – must be totally comfortable at the command line
- You have the ability to write clean, modular, and tested code.
- You are a fast learner to get new design and technology concepts.
- Strong programming skills in C++11/17
- Strong understanding of multithreading, synchronization, and concurrent programming
- Detailed knowledge of Linux Graphics, mainly 2D and blending/compositing acceleration
- Bonus points for any background with SmartTV technology
Preferences:
Multimedia
Job Responsibilities:
- Coding, Debugging, Bug fixing and so on that is required to release a software package.
- Research and implement functional requirements using up-to-date technology and skills.
- Design the software architecture to support the requirements
- Review the software design and implementations.
- Maintain the code clean, and modular for cross-platform architecture.
What We Offer
Exciting Projects: With clients across all industries and sectors, we offer an opportunity to work on market-defining products using the latest technologies.
Collaborative Environment: You can expand your skills by collaborating with a diverse team of highly talented people in an open, laidback environment — or even abroad in one of our global centers or client facilities!
Work-Life Balance: GlobalLogic prioritizes work-life balance, which is why we offer flexible work schedules.
Professional Development: We develop paths suited to your individual talents through international knowledge exchanges and professional certification opportunities.
Excellent Benefits: We provide our employees with private medical care, sports facilities cards, group life insurance, travel insurance, relocation package, food subsidies, and cultural activities.
Fun Perks: We want you to feel comfortable in your work, which is why we create a good working environment with relaxed zones, host social and teambuilding activities, and stock our kitchen with delicious teas and coffees!